1.3.1.5
AMC Interfaces
•
AMC finger connector supports sRIO AMC backplane
•
AMC finger connector supports MMC including I2C
•
AMC finger connector supports port 0 GigE (1000Base-BX) interface to RJ45 through the
VSC8221 PHY (AMC.2)
•
AMC finger connector does not support JTAG
•
3.3V management power; maximum 100 mA from figure connector
•
AMC vertical slot connector does not support JTAG, I2C, and MMC functions
•
AMC vertical slot shared with 12V power and local 3.3V
•
Total power consumption including PrPMC and AMC slot should not be more than 60W
